Capacity and Decision-Making

When someone’s ability to make sound decisions is compromised by illness, injury, or age-related changes, it may be necessary to seek legal authority to safeguard their interests. Where there are no Enduring Powers of Attorney in place and it is too late to put them in place, applying to the court to be appointed as a welfare guardian or property manager allows a trusted person to make important decisions about the individual’s care or finances. Issues with Enduring Powers of Attorney

Enduring Powers of Attorney (EPOAs) are intended to protect a person’s interests when they can no longer manage their affairs. However, disagreements may arise if the appointed attorney is making questionable choices or failing to act in the donor’s best interests. Retirement Village and Rest Home Agreements

Choosing to move into a retirement village or rest home is a significant step. The agreements tied to these facilities can be complex, involving fees, rules, and obligations that may vary from place to place. Elder Abuse

Elder abuse may be physical, emotional, or financial, and can happen even within a family context. If you think someone is being mistreated, it is crucial to seek legal help right away.
